News: 23/02/2021
It's been a while since our last update, because there's not been any news. The SkegMiniFest elves (and our one gnome) were underground, plotting, scheming and generally working out what we can do to put the event on in 2021.
It's become apparent that unfortunately, we can't.
Although we now have a roadmap to come out of lockdown, so many things could still delay each step. This makes it almost impossible to plan SkegMiniFest 2021.
If we make the assumption that all will be well and all restrictions are lifted in June (which is the only point at which we could hold the event), but something went wrong, we'd have to cancel again. This costs us time and money and it causes more hassle for the staff and our guests.
Even if it all went well, all the bands that support us and play for free would most be likely to be gigging - we can't expect them to turn down paid gigs after more than a year without income from live music, and the amount of notice we'd have either way wouldn't be practical for us or the bands.
So really we're still in a pickle for this year. We've got to stay safe, sensible and legal for a bit longer, and we just can't balance everything out.
To all those who carried over your bookings from 2020, we thank you again for your continued support and can assure you that whatever happens, you've paid for the next event and your bookings are secured. You do still have the choice of a refund but as we promised last year, if you carry over your booking to 2022, you will still pay no more than you already have for the next event.

news: 13/04/2020
SkegMiniFest 2020 has been cancelled
It is with great regret that we have cancelled SkegMiniFest 2020.
The current situation still brings us great uncertainty and there are so many aspects of SkegMiniFest that are affected even before starting the event itself.
Given this, and our desire to put on the best event we can, we've taken the decision that the 10th anniversary event which would have happened this year will be postponed until 2021.
We will shortly be contacting all existing bookings to see if people would prefer a refund of this year's booking, or to transfer their booking to next year. When the booking pages reopen, they will be for 2021 bookings.
